(C) Ambassador met December 11 with Somaliland Minister of Foreign Affairs Abdillahi Mohamed Duale to discus recent improvements in relations between Djibouti and Somaliland, which had been strained since the GODJ's closure of Somaliland's trade mission in Djibouti in 2006. Duale reported that "things were moving in the right direction," although press reports that a new Somaliland mission might open as early as this month are likely premature. Duale reported that he had held a series of fruitful meetings with the GODJ Minister of Foreign Affairs, the Minister of Finance, and the Governor of the Central Bank. Duale said that Somaliland and the GODJ had agreed to establish a joint Ministerial Commission, slated to meet every six months in alternating capitals, as well as a technical-level committee to meet more frequently. In addition, Duale said that Djibouti's Banque pour le Commerce et l'Industrie (BCI),in which the GODJ holds a 33% share, had "already made a decision" to establish a branch office in Hargeisa. Duale said that he planned to meet again with Djibouti's Minister of Finance to set a more exact timetable for BCI's opening in Somaliland. ¶2. (C) During the meeting, Duale reiterated reftel points that he was looking forward to the "imminent" completion of AU Special Envoy Bwakira's report on his assessment mission to Somaliland, and to his own upcoming series of meetings in Addis Ababa with the AU and GOE to press for formal recognition. Duale added that Somaliland President Riyale is planning to travel to Addis and possibly Kigali to rally support. Duale also repeated reftel appeal for enhanced U.S.-Somaliland cooperation on counterterrorism. ¶3. (C) COMMENT. Djibouti-Somaliland relations appear on the mend. Somaliland reportedly offered livestock and other food to the GODJ in the aftermath of the Eritrean incursion in June. Duale commented favorably on President Ismail Omar Guelleh's immediate and personal concern over the October 29 bombing in Hargeisa. Duale was well-received at senior levels in Djibouti and confirmed he plans further follow-up visits. END COMMENT. SWAN
